1a280dd4bd net/sched: cls_flow: fix NULL pointer dereference on shared blocks
flow_change() calls tcf_block_q() and dereferences q->handle to derive
a default baseclass.  Shared blocks leave block->q NULL, causing a NULL
deref when a flow filter without a fully qualified baseclass is created
on a shared block.

Check tcf_block_shared() before accessing block->q and return -EINVAL
for shared blocks.  This avoids the null-deref shown below:

faeea8bbf6 net/sched: cls_fw: fix NULL pointer dereference on shared blocks
The old-method path in fw_classify() calls tcf_block_q() and
dereferences q->handle.  Shared blocks leave block->q NULL, causing a
NULL deref when an empty cls_fw filter is attached to a shared block
and a packet with a nonzero major skb mark is classified.

Reject the configuration in fw_change() when the old method (no
TCA_OPTIONS) is used on a shared block, since fw_classify()'s
old-method path needs block->q which is NULL for shared blocks.

ba2c83167b misc: fastrpc: possible double-free of cctx->remote_heap
fastrpc_init_create_static_process() may free cctx->remote_heap on the
err_map path but does not clear the pointer. Later, fastrpc_rpmsg_remove()
frees cctx->remote_heap again if it is non-NULL, which can lead to a
double-free if the INIT_CREATE_STATIC ioctl hits the error path and the rpmsg
device is subsequently removed/unbound.
Clear cctx->remote_heap after freeing it in the error path to prevent the
later cleanup from freeing it again.

93853512f5 comedi: dt2815: add hardware detection to prevent crash
The dt2815 driver crashes when attached to I/O ports without actual
hardware present. This occurs because syzkaller or users can attach
the driver to arbitrary I/O addresses via COMEDI_DEVCONFIG ioctl.

When no hardware exists at the specified port, inb() operations return
0xff (floating bus), but outb() operations can trigger page faults due
to undefined behavior, especially under race conditions:

  BUG: unable to handle page fault for address: 000000007fffff90
  #PF: supervisor write access in kernel mode
  #PF: error_code(0x0002) - not-present page
  RIP: 0010:dt2815_attach+0x6e0/0x1110

Add hardware detection by reading the status register before attempting
any write operations. If the read returns 0xff, assume no hardware is
present and fail the attach with -ENODEV. This prevents crashes from
outb() operations on non-existent hardware.

4b9a9a6d71 comedi: Reinit dev->spinlock between attachments to low-level drivers
`struct comedi_device` is the main controlling structure for a COMEDI
device created by the COMEDI subsystem.  It contains a member `spinlock`
containing a spin-lock that is initialized by the COMEDI subsystem, but
is reserved for use by a low-level driver attached to the COMEDI device
(at least since commit 25436dc9d8 ("Staging: comedi: remove RT
code")).

Some COMEDI devices (those created on initialization of the COMEDI
subsystem when the "comedi.comedi_num_legacy_minors" parameter is
non-zero) can be attached to different low-level drivers over their
lifetime using the `COMEDI_DEVCONFIG` ioctl command.  This can result in
inconsistent lock states being reported when there is a mismatch in the
spin-lock locking levels used by each low-level driver to which the
COMEDI device has been attached.  Fix it by reinitializing
`dev->spinlock` before calling the low-level driver's `attach` function
pointer if `CONFIG_LOCKDEP` is enabled.

cc797d4821 comedi: me_daq: Fix potential overrun of firmware buffer
`me2600_xilinx_download()` loads the firmware that was requested by
`request_firmware()`.  It is possible for it to overrun the source
buffer because it blindly trusts the file format.  It reads a data
stream length from the first 4 bytes into variable `file_length` and
reads the data stream contents of length `file_length` from offset 16
onwards.  Although it checks that the supplied firmware is at least 16
bytes long, it does not check that it is long enough to contain the data
stream.

Add a test to ensure that the supplied firmware is long enough to
contain the header and the data stream.  On failure, log an error and
return `-EINVAL`.

101ab946b7 comedi: ni_atmio16d: Fix invalid clean-up after failed attach
If the driver's COMEDI "attach" handler function (`atmio16d_attach()`)
returns an error, the COMEDI core will call the driver's "detach"
handler function (`atmio16d_detach()`) to clean up.  This calls
`reset_atmio16d()` unconditionally, but depending on where the error
occurred in the attach handler, the device may not have been
sufficiently initialized to call `reset_atmio16d()`.  It uses
`dev->iobase` as the I/O port base address and `dev->private` as the
pointer to the COMEDI device's private data structure.  `dev->iobase`
may still be set to its initial value of 0, which would result in
undesired writes to low I/O port addresses.  `dev->private` may still be
`NULL`, which would result in null pointer dereferences.

Fix `atmio16d_detach()` by checking that `dev->private` is valid
(non-null) before calling `reset_atmio16d()`.  This implies that
`dev->iobase` was set correctly since that is set up before
`dev->private`.

d1857f8296 gpib: fix use-after-free in IO ioctl handlers
The IBRD, IBWRT, IBCMD, and IBWAIT ioctl handlers use a gpib_descriptor
pointer after board->big_gpib_mutex has been released.  A concurrent
IBCLOSEDEV ioctl can free the descriptor via close_dev_ioctl() during
this window, causing a use-after-free.

The IO handlers (read_ioctl, write_ioctl, command_ioctl) explicitly
release big_gpib_mutex before calling their handler.  wait_ioctl() is
called with big_gpib_mutex held, but ibwait() releases it internally
when wait_mask is non-zero.  In all four cases, the descriptor pointer
obtained from handle_to_descriptor() becomes unprotected.

Fix this by introducing a kernel-only descriptor_busy reference count
in struct gpib_descriptor.  Each handler atomically increments
descriptor_busy under file_priv->descriptors_mutex before releasing the
lock, and decrements it when done.  close_dev_ioctl() checks
descriptor_busy under the same lock and rejects the close with -EBUSY
if the count is non-zero.

A reference count rather than a simple flag is necessary because
multiple handlers can operate on the same descriptor concurrently
(e.g. IBRD and IBWAIT on the same handle from different threads).

A separate counter is needed because io_in_progress can be cleared from
unprivileged userspace via the IBWAIT ioctl (through general_ibstatus()
with set_mask containing CMPL), which would allow an attacker to bypass
a check based solely on io_in_progress.  The new descriptor_busy
counter is only modified by the kernel IO paths.

The lock ordering is consistent (big_gpib_mutex -> descriptors_mutex)
and the handlers only hold descriptors_mutex briefly during the lookup,
so there is no deadlock risk and no impact on IO throughput.

1319ea5752 sched/fair: Fix zero_vruntime tracking fix
John reported that stress-ng-yield could make his machine unhappy and
managed to bisect it to commit b3d99f43c7 ("sched/fair: Fix
zero_vruntime tracking").

The combination of yield and that commit was specific enough to
hypothesize the following scenario:

Suppose we have 2 runnable tasks, both doing yield. Then one will be
eligible and one will not be, because the average position must be in
between these two entities.

Therefore, the runnable task will be eligible, and be promoted a full
slice (all the tasks do is yield after all). This causes it to jump over
the other task and now the other task is eligible and current is no
longer. So we schedule.

Since we are runnable, there is no {de,en}queue. All we have is the
__{en,de}queue_entity() from {put_prev,set_next}_task(). But per the
fingered commit, those two no longer move zero_vruntime.

All that moves zero_vruntime are tick and full {de,en}queue.

This means, that if the two tasks playing leapfrog can reach the
critical speed to reach the overflow point inside one tick's worth of
time, we're up a creek.

Additionally, when multiple cgroups are involved, there is no guarantee
the tick will in fact hit every cgroup in a timely manner. Statistically
speaking it will, but that same statistics does not rule out the
possibility of one cgroup not getting a tick for a significant amount of
time -- however unlikely.

Therefore, just like with the yield() case, force an update at the end
of every slice. This ensures the update is never more than a single
slice behind and the whole thing is within 2 lag bounds as per the
comment on entity_key().

4e0a88254a usb: gadget: f_hid: move list and spinlock inits from bind to alloc
There was an issue when you did the following:
- setup and bind an hid gadget
- open /dev/hidg0
- use the resulting fd in EPOLL_CTL_ADD
- unbind the UDC
- bind the UDC
- use the fd in EPOLL_CTL_DEL

When CONFIG_DEBUG_LIST was enabled, a list_del corruption was reported
within remove_wait_queue (via ep_remove_wait_queue). After some
debugging I found out that the queues, which f_hid registers via
poll_wait were the problem. These were initialized using
init_waitqueue_head inside hidg_bind. So effectively, the bind function
re-initialized the queues while there were still items in them.

The solution is to move the initialization from hidg_bind to hidg_alloc
to extend their lifetimes to the lifetime of the function instance.

Additionally, I found many other possibly problematic init calls in the
bind function, which I moved as well.

8b7a42ecdc USB: core: add NO_LPM quirk for Razer Kiyo Pro webcam
The Razer Kiyo Pro (1532:0e05) is a USB 3.0 UVC webcam whose firmware
does not handle USB Link Power Management transitions reliably. When LPM
is active, the device can enter a state where it fails to respond to
control transfers, producing EPIPE (-32) errors on UVC probe control
SET_CUR requests. In the worst case, the stalled endpoint triggers an
xHCI stop-endpoint command that times out, causing the host controller
to be declared dead and every USB device on the bus to be disconnected.

This has been reported as Ubuntu Launchpad Bug #2061177. The failure
mode is:

  1. UVC probe control SET_CUR returns -32 (EPIPE)
  2. xHCI host not responding to stop endpoint command
  3. xHCI host controller not responding, assume dead
  4. All USB devices on the affected xHCI controller disconnect

Disabling LPM prevents the firmware from entering the problematic low-
power states that precede the stall. This is the same approach used for
other webcams with similar firmware issues (e.g., Logitech HD Webcam C270).

0179c6da07 usb: core: phy: avoid double use of 'usb3-phy'
Commit 53a2d95df8 ("usb: core: add phy notify connect and disconnect")
causes double use of the 'usb3-phy' in certain cases.

Since that commit, if a generic PHY named 'usb3-phy' is specified in
the device tree, that is getting added to the 'phy_roothub' list of the
secondary HCD by the usb_phy_roothub_alloc_usb3_phy() function. However,
that PHY is getting added also to the primary HCD's 'phy_roothub' list
by usb_phy_roothub_alloc() if there is no generic PHY specified with
'usb2-phy' name.

This causes that the usb_add_hcd() function executes each phy operations
twice on the 'usb3-phy'. Once when the primary HCD is added, then once
again when the secondary HCD is added.

The issue affects the Marvell Armada 3700 platform at least, where a
custom name is used for the USB2 PHY:

  $ git grep 'phy-names.*usb3' arch/arm64/boot/dts/marvell/armada-37xx.dtsi | tr '\t' ' '
  arch/arm64/boot/dts/marvell/armada-37xx.dtsi:    phy-names = "usb3-phy", "usb2-utmi-otg-phy";

Extend the usb_phy_roothub_alloc_usb3_phy() function to skip adding the
'usb3-phy' to the 'phy_roothub' list of the secondary HCD when 'usb2-phy'
is not specified in the device tree to avoid the double use.

Michael Chan
e4bf81dcad bnxt_en: Don't assume XDP is never enabled in bnxt_init_dflt_ring_mode()
The original code made the assumption that when we set up the initial
default ring mode, we must be just loading the driver and XDP cannot
be enabled yet.  This is not true when the FW goes through a resource
or capability change.  Resource reservations will be cancelled and
reinitialized with XDP already enabled.  devlink reload with XDP enabled
will also have the same issue.  This scenario will cause the ring
arithmetic to be all wrong in the bnxt_init_dflt_ring_mode() path
causing failure:

bnxt_en 0000:a1:00.0 ens2f0np0: bnxt_setup_int_mode err: ffffffea
bnxt_en 0000:a1:00.0 ens2f0np0: bnxt_request_irq err: ffffffea
bnxt_en 0000:a1:00.0 ens2f0np0: nic open fail (rc: ffffffea)

Fix it by properly accounting for XDP in the bnxt_init_dflt_ring_mode()
path by using the refactored helper functions in the previous patch.
